Transaction 0abb25a9515defd81beef07dff35766baedb8251a071f13f8bcbf7d4d6456875
1 Input
1 Output
-
0abb25a9515defd81beef07dff35766baedb8251a071f13f8bcbf7d4d6456875:0
- value
- 886248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77e35571521146ac557d1c5abf95f2657faf5e4b OP_EQUAL
- address
- 3CcvfoFFoccHEhd8CFfsgramLJYPEXTF8H